docker_clean() {
local images=$(docker images -qf "dangling=true")
- [ -n "$images" ] && docker rmi -f $images | sed "s/^/images /"
+ [ -n "$images" ] && docker rmi -f $images | sed "s/^/IMAGES /"
local volumes=$(docker volume ls -qf dangling=true)
- [ -n "$volumes" ] && docker volume rm $volumes | sed "s/^/volumes /"
+ [ -n "$volumes" ] && docker volume rm $volumes | sed "s/^/VOLUMES /"
local containers=$(docker ps -f status=dead -f status=exited -f status=created -aq)
- [ -n "$containers" ] && docker rm -vf $containers | sed "s/^/containers /"
+ [ -n "$containers" ] && docker rm -vf $containers | sed "s/^/CONTAINERS /"
}
#[ -n "$containers" -a -n "$volumes" -a -n "$images" ]